Quote: Inflatable_Armadillo "You clearly can't read and must be poor at maths! £12k sounds ok to me and £24k would not be the end of the world but doubt it would be that much by a long way. So to cover my £12k hire I only need 600 paying adults through the gate and then I am in profit, I can hire some office space in Wakefield to run my admin team and ticket office out of for next to bugger all a m2, and then I just need some training facilities which I can hire ad-hoc in Wakefield or Barnsley. No PL insurance to pay, no ground staff to pay, no rates, no buildings insurance or ground maintenance costs... makes you wonder why more clubs in SL don't ground share... hang on...
My reading and maths are fine thanks. You must be a wealthy guy. First you say hiring Oakwell wont cost much then 'accpet' £12-£24K as being okay. For the finances of a club like wakey £12k to £24k ('not the end of the world' icon_rolleyes.gif )is substantial.

The '£12k = 600 fully paying adults' is toytown economics. Almost as idiotic as the offices / training facilities being easy to get and 'costing b*gger all'. It is this slap dash attitude to what things actually cost that leads to many organisations having financial problems. Incidentally while you used 600 full paying adults at £20(?) as an ilustration the average payment per fan at a wakey game is likely to be £8 -£10 - this takes into account concessions, season tickets, junior tickets and some free tickets. so it is closer to 1200 to 1500 attendees to cover £12K. HTH

I think the £15000 per game for a 23000 stadium like Oakwell is a reasonable assumption. So a seasons hire would be 13 x £15K. £195K (assuming no friendlies or cup games). Add office space for business staff and for coaches. A shop(?)Add training facilities and playing faclities for junior grade games that were played at Belle Vue. Now you think the savings in insurance + ground maintainance + ground staff (are these guys going to be fired?) will be greater than £195k + all the other costs. You are totally deluded and I hope no one like you is advising wakey.

However the financial situation would be worse than this. There would be loses on hosipitality + ground advertising + stadium naming rights. There are additonal marketing costs (to tell people about the new venue) stationary costs etc. And there is every likelihood that over the season the attendances woud be down as some people will not travel.

To try and claim that moving to Oakwell for a season is economically beneficial may be comforting to some wakey fans however it is delusional. The Trinity and RFL boards are highly unlikely to share this dilusion.
